WebMedical and surgical abortions can generally only be carried out up to 24 weeks of pregnancy. In very limited circumstances an abortion can take place after 24 weeks – for example, if there's a risk to life or there are problems with the baby's development. An abortion may be performed up to the time when the foetus is viable outside the mother’s body. Under the Criminal Code, this is 24 weeks. WebAbortion is the termination of a pregnancy by removal or expulsion of an embryo or fetus. An abortion that occurs without intervention is known as a miscarriage or "spontaneous abortion"; these occur in approximately 30% to 40% of pregnancies. WebWhen during pregnancy do most abortions occur? The vast majority of abortions occur during the first trimester of a pregnancy. In 2024, 93% of abortions occurred during the first trimester – that is, at or before 13 weeks of gestation, according to the CDC.
